Output eb670e546d26c32ae99a384023fb707f6041158fdd7a17796597624b4f99007a:2

value
20000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 97cbabc92e7bedf55cf550d3950dc87a7fc7d711 OP_EQUALVERIFY OP_CHECKSIG
address
1Eqd2H8zywKZxRAgCwMUHqxjrjsbTkHrLz
transaction
eb670e546d26c32ae99a384023fb707f6041158fdd7a17796597624b4f99007a
spent
true